Julie L.

Brilliant experience at the Fernhill wool school. I learnt so much, great teachers, the most inspiring couple running this incredible eco farm. Sustainability and animal welfare at the heart of what they do, plus then seeing how it goes from field to fibre - loved it. I stayed in Wren cottage in the horseshoe barn. Really quirky and a great place to take your family for a digital free experience near Cheddar. It is a working farm so the driveway is bumpy lol, and as a solar powered farm dress warm in cooler months. Loved every minute - just brilliant - thanks to Jen Andy and the team - AMAZING

Bonnie H.
5/5

About half an hour by taxi from Bristol (£30-50 in a taxi) this is a really unusual event venue. We had our away days here and had amazing catering from Keren and a warm welcome by Jen and Andy who run the place. Jules, the event manager, really helped make sure we had what we needed, including a blazing fire in the yard and extra towels for campers. All the ooms and beds were comfy and characterful, and some even came with cuddly cats. The Horseshoe Barn had loads of space for us to spread out and work or huddle for more intimate chats. We had a great time!

Brenda H.
5/5

Ideal place for purchasing fleece and all things woolly. Home raised beef, lamb and pork. Mutton Club, run once a month in the winter months, is superb. Bring your own booze. Wool classes available. Shearing/open days . NB it’s a working farm so No dogs allowed.
